Uproar over Nagpur Pitch in 2004

However, instructions to change this pitch of Nagpur have not been given for the first time, but earlier in the year 2004, there was a ruckus regarding this pitch.

In 2004, on this pitch of Nagpur, the captaincy of Team India was in the hands of Sourav Ganguly, during that time Team India had to play against Australia only.

Ganguly left the match due to differences:-

But in this match, Ganguly did not play the match on the pretext of injury. While there were reports that Ganguly left the match due to differences with former coach Greg Chappell, former Nagpur curator Kishor Pradhan told a different story.

Pradhan had claimed that Ganguly had given instructions to change the pitch. After seeing the green pitch for the Nagpur Test at that time.

Ganguly had asked to change the pitch considering the strength and weakness of both teams but I said that the pitch cannot be changed after which he did not play the match due to injury.

Nagpur Pitch was ‘lucky’ for Ashwin:-

Significantly, during that time the visiting team won the match by 342 runs. And 23 out of 35 wickets in the match were taken by the fast bowlers. However, India’s performance on home pitches has always been impressive, mostly dominated by the bowlers.

India has played 6 Test matches at the Vidarbha Cricket Association Stadium in Nagpur. Out of which they have won 4, lost 1, and drawn one match. This stadium is famous for R Ashwin. He has played 3 Tests on this pitch in which he has taken 23 wickets.
